Barcelona GSE Scholarship Details:

The Barcelona School of Economics is offering full GSE scholarships to eligible international students for an opportunity to study in Spain.

 

Each year, the School of Economics award an average of 800,000€ in merit-based funding to Master’s students. Around 36% of matriculated students have received full or partial funding for their studies.

Requirements for Barcelona Graduate School of Economics Scholarship 2025

To be considered for the Barcelona Graduate School of Economics Scholarship, you must:

 

submit a completed application before July 2, 2025

receive an offer of admission to BSE

have demonstrated their potential to succeed in the school’s rigorous, intensive Master’s programs.

meet the programs requirements

meet the school’s English Language requirements

Types of funding that may be offered to candidates include:

 

Waivers covering 25%, 50%, 75% or 100% of tuition fees

A limited number of fully-funded scholarships (100% of fees and some additional stipend, depending on the scholarship)

Required Documents for Barcelona GSE Scholarship

To apply, candidates must be ready to submit the following documents;

 

Application Form

Undergraduate academic transcripts or mark sheets

Copy of your undergraduate diploma

Copy of your passport

Curriculum Vitae (CV)

Statement of Purpose

Proof of English language knowledge

If you are applying to the PhD Track Program, you are required to submit a GRE score.
